SELFPHP

SELFPHP-Druckversion
Original Adresse dieser Seite:
http://www.selfphp.de/funktionsreferenz/mysql_funktionen/mysql_errno.php
© 2001-2017 E-Mail SELFPHP OHG, info@selfphp.de



mysql_errno


nach unten nach oben Befehl

int mysql_errno ( [resource $ Verbindungs-Kennung ] )



nach unten nach oben Version

(PHP 4, PHP 5, PECL mysql:1.0)



nach unten nach oben Beschreibung

Mit mysql_errno() kann man sich die Fehlernummer einer zuvor ausgeführten Operation zurückgeben lassen. Da MySQL-Fehler nicht zu einer Ausgabe von Fehlermeldungen führen und das Skript normal weiter durchlaufen wird, sollten Sie sich diese Fehlernummer zurückgeben lassen, um den Fehler zu beseitigen. Mit dem optionalen Verbindungsparameter (Verbindungs-Kennung) können Sie eine explizite Verbindungskennung angeben. Falls diese fehlt, wird auf die aktuelle Verbindung zurückgegriffen. Sollte dies auch fehlschlagen, wird versucht, eine Verbindung ohne Angaben von Argumenten (siehe mysql_connect) zu erstellen. Im unteren Beispiel wurde versucht, auf eine Tabelle (self) zuzugreifen, welche in der Datenbank "selfphp" nicht existent ist.

Siehe auch:

mysql_connect()
mysql_error()



nach unten nach oben Datenbank


Aktuelle Tabellen in Datenbank selfphp
   
----------------------
| selfphp_forum      |
----------------------
| selfphp_funktionen |
----------------------
| selfphp_guestbook  |
------- --------------
| selfphp_statistik  |
----------------------




nach unten nach oben Beispiel


<?PHP
/* Datenbankserver - In der Regel die IP */
$db_server 'localhost';

/* Datenbankname */
$db_name 'selfphp';

/* Datenbankuser */
$db_user 'root';

/* Datenbankpasswort */
$db_passwort 'thunderbird';
         
/* Erstellt Connect zu Datenbank her */
$db = @ mysql_connect $db_server$db_user$db_passwort );

mysql_select_db 'selfphp'$db );

$sql 'SELECT
          *
        FROM
          `self`'
;

$result mysql_query $sql );

if ( 
$result )
{
  echo 
mysql_num_rows $result );
}
else
{
  echo 
'Fehler-Nr. ' mysql_errno () . ' - ' mysql_error ();
}
?>




nach unten nach oben Ausgabe


Fehler-Nr. 1146 - Table 'selfphp.self' doesn't exist